Little Bits of Life:  Goddess in White Roses


Perhaps it’s better, not
to be able to see into the future.

Too surreal, it would have been, seeing
your coffin wheeled down the center aisle, standing
room only in the church.

We draped you in white roses, a testament
to the healer you were—
nurse, yet wife, mother, daughter, friend, and
they were the color of your clothing
in the dream, where you now live.

They spoke in Latin as the incense bell waved its scent
across the aisles, and ah, this life—
its little bits, that added up to now.

There is far more godliness in the everyday
than in glitz on pedestals, and
no deities real or fake
could’ve put up with the shit you did
at the end.

I shall bring the garden to you, in hallowed places
as I do, others, who have gone your way, and Godspeed—

Godspeed into hands that give, that create
as you gave, when we all fell apart, for
that is the measure of a goddess.


(a tribute to friend of 30 years, who was a "goddess" in many ways--until we meet again, M.B.

Daughters Of Time

 

In endless vigil are watcher’s fair the maidens of eternity.
To keep now’s space between what once was and what has yet to be.
Forever’s children have not taken rest their guard has just begun.
Theirs is to stir wait’s solitude a god to nothing quickly done.
From beyond to beyond through the book of life they turn another page.
In time beats there pulse with every step marched across the age.
Know the future holds not a blessing or a curse upon the past.
Deny each their due and in its wake the first shall be the last.
When the elder’s lessons are forgotten through the lack of care.
Pain and burdens is the payment for later souls to bear.
Weaker wills who choose not to see what the future has in store.
Their prospects are an empty pit that yields precious little more.
Then there are the foolish ones who fear the here and now.
A squandered gift is there present this they’ll disavow.
When wish and hope are prayed upon they hold each other’s hand.
The past and present bleed into now so those seeking understand.
Sacred sisters of timeless beauty born from tranquility.
These graced goddesses ward the worlds of man’s reality.
